The University of North Carolina-Charlotte’s Belk College of Business sits just outside North Carolina’s largest city. According to the school, Charlotte is the 16th largest city in the country and the second-largest financial services center. While the Belk College sits a bit removed from Charlotte’s city center, students can take a light-rail public transit system to the center.

Students at Belk may choose from nine different majors, with the most recently established ones being a business analytics major and a finance major in real estate. According to Belk College officials, the school has also increased its programming and offerings for professional development which has included professional development learning opportunities in core courses as well as developing programming in the Niblock Student Center.

“The Niblock Student Center in the Belk College of Business helps students identify and plan for their career goals, cultivate career-ready skills and network with business employers through individual coaching, professional development workshops, and experiential education,” school officials said in the school survey submittted to Poets&Quants for Undergrads. “Niblock Student Center staff partner with the University Career Center to serve business students. The University Career Center offers resources and career services (including a centralized job-posting website) to all students at the University.”

For last year’s graduating class, 67% had internships before graduation. Out of those seeking employment for the Class of 2019, some 76.89% had full-time employment within three months of graduation. Those with employment reported an average salary of $49,069. About a quarter (23.49%) of the class reported earning an average signing bonus of $1,825. Three months after graduation, 18.84% of the class was still seeking employment and 8.9% decided to continue their education.

Financial services firms and banks were some of the most popular landing areas for Belk College graduates immediately after graduation. Bank of America hired the most 2019 graduates with 32 electing to work for the bank. Wells Fargo followed in popularity this year with 14 graduates going to work there. Both Bank of America and Wells Fargo were the top-two hiring firms last year as well.

This was the first year the Belk College was ranked in Poets&Quants for Undergrads’ Best Business School Rankings and the school debuted at No. 75. Belk scored best in the admissions category where it placed 68th. Belk’s alumni also rated the school favorably, giving it a No. 71 ranking in the alumni experience category. Unfortunately, Belk was held back in the employment outcomes category because of relatively low employment and internship percentages as well as lower salaries for its graduates.

However, the Belk College offers a unique place to earn a degree in the southeast as one of a few schools — especially in North Carolina — to sit at the edge of such a financial services hub.

Where the Class of 2019 went to work:

1. Bank of America Corporation – 32

2. Wells Fargo & Company – 14

3. TIAA – 8

4. Independent – 7

5. Zentra, LLC – 6

6. Lowe’s Companies, Inc – 5

7. Duke Energy Corporation – 4

8. Fastenal – 4

9. Target – 4

10. Townsquare Interactive – 4
